about summary refs log tree commit diff
path: root/compiler/rustc_const_eval/messages.ftl
AgeCommit message (Expand)AuthorLines
2025-09-24const validation: better error for maybe-null referencesRalf Jung-2/+8
2025-09-24const-eval: improve and actually test the errors when pointers might be outsi...Ralf Jung-2/+2
2025-09-03don't uppercase error messagesSasha Pourcelot-1/+1
2025-08-17Auto merge of #144081 - RalfJung:const-ptr-fragments, r=oli-obkbors-5/+6
2025-07-30const-eval: full support for pointer fragmentsRalf Jung-5/+6
2025-07-27miri: for ABI mismatch errors, say which argument is the problemRalf Jung-3/+3
2025-07-17Rollup merge of #143595 - fee1-dead-contrib:push-sylpykzkmynr, r=RalfJung,fee...León Orell Valerian Liehr-0/+11
2025-07-16Rollup merge of #143692 - RalfJung:miri-oob, r=oli-obkSamuel Tardieu-12/+15
2025-07-16add `const_make_global`; err for `const_allocate` ptrs if didn't callDeadbeef-0/+11
2025-07-09miri: fix out-of-bounds error for ptrs with negative offsetsRalf Jung-12/+15
2025-07-09Add opaque TypeId handles for CTFEOli Scherer-0/+2
2025-06-30Remove the nullary intrinsic const eval logic and treat them like other intri...Oli Scherer-3/+0
2025-06-27Rollup merge of #143092 - RalfJung:const-check-lifetime-ext, r=oli-obkMatthias Krüger-18/+10
2025-06-27const checks: avoid 'top-level scope' terminologyRalf Jung-18/+10
2025-06-27const-eval: error when initializing a static writes to that staticRalf Jung-1/+1
2025-06-26clarify and unify 'transient mutable borrow' errorsRalf Jung-17/+10
2025-06-26const-eval: allow constants to refer to mutable/external memory, but reject s...Ralf Jung-5/+1
2025-06-07const-eval error: always say in which item the error occurredRalf Jung-5/+3
2025-06-03Rollup merge of #141698 - oli-obk:ctfe-err-flip, r=RalfJungMatthias Krüger-3/+3
2025-06-03Rollup merge of #141569 - workingjubilee:canonicalize-abi, r=bjorn3Matthias Krüger-1/+1
2025-06-03compiler: change Conv to CanonAbiJubilee Young-1/+1
2025-06-02Clarify why we are talking about a failed const eval at a random placeOli Scherer-3/+3
2025-05-25const-check: stop recommending the use of rustc_allow_const_fn_unstableRalf Jung-2/+1
2025-04-30interpret: better error message for out-of-bounds pointer arithmetic and acce...Ralf Jung-35/+35
2025-03-20Use def_path_str for def id arg in UnsupportedOpInfoMichael Goulet-2/+2
2025-02-28Shorten span of panic failures in const contextEsteban Küber-2/+3
2025-02-02miri: improve error when offset_from preconditions are violatedRalf Jung-1/+3
2025-01-28Implement MIR const trait stability checksDeadbeef-1/+2
2025-01-25Fix typo in const stability error messageDeadbeef-1/+1
2025-01-18Structured suggestion for "missing `feature` intrinsic"Esteban Küber-1/+1
2025-01-09Unify conditional and non const call error reportingMichael Goulet-8/+6
2025-01-09Make the non-const part swappable in the diagnosticMichael Goulet-27/+32
2024-12-23Note def descr in NonConstFunctionCallMichael Goulet-1/+1
2024-11-22Get rid of HIR const checkerMichael Goulet-4/+4
2024-11-18rename rustc_const_stable_intrinsic -> rustc_intrinsic_const_stable_indirectRalf Jung-1/+1
2024-11-09require const_impl_trait gate for all conditional and trait const callsRalf Jung-0/+4
2024-11-04add new rustc_const_stable_intrinsic attribute for const-stable intrinsicsRalf Jung-1/+1
2024-11-03remove const-support for align_offsetRalf Jung-3/+0
2024-10-25Re-do recursive const stability checksRalf Jung-7/+20
2024-10-08fix/update teach_note from 'escaping mutable ref/ptr' const-checkRalf Jung-25/+26
2024-09-23Check vtable projections for validity in miriMichael Goulet-2/+2
2024-09-15also stabilize const_refs_to_cellRalf Jung-3/+0
2024-09-15stabilize const_mut_refsRalf Jung-7/+0
2024-08-31make the const-unstable-in-stable error more clearRalf Jung-2/+2
2024-08-26interpret: do not make const-eval query result depend on tcx.sessRalf Jung-3/+0
2024-08-25tweak rustc_allow_const_fn_unstable hint, and add back test for stable-const-...Ralf Jung-1/+1
2024-08-10rustc_const_eval: make LazyLock suggestion translatablePavel Grigorenko-0/+3
2024-08-10rustc_const_eval: make message about "const stable" translatablePavel Grigorenko-0/+2
2024-08-02Rollup merge of #128453 - RalfJung:raw_eq, r=saethlinMatthias Krüger-3/+0
2024-08-01fix the way we detect overflow for inbounds arithmetic (and tweak the error m...Ralf Jung-1/+1